CONCURRENT RESOLUTION
         WHEREAS, The year 2007 marks the 100th anniversary of Saint
  Joseph Catholic Church in Rowena, and this noteworthy occasion
  provides a welcome opportunity to reflect on the church's rich
  history; and
         WHEREAS, An enduring center of community life, the church
  dates back to the early 1900s, when a wave of new residents, many of
  them Catholic farmers of German and Czech heritage, arrived in the
  area; in the fall of 1907, construction of the initial Saint Joseph
  Catholic Church building was completed, and the first mass was
  celebrated on November 20 of that year; in 1924, that church was
  replaced by an impressive Gothic structure, which continues to
  serve the membership today; and
         WHEREAS, Over the decades, Saint Joseph's has been a
  reassuring presence for area citizens as they faced the challenges
  and opportunities of their times; through the tumultuous years of
  the Great Depression and World War II and again during the extreme
  drought that seized the area in the 1950s, the church helped unite
  the community and provided vital solace and support; and
         WHEREAS, From 1916 until the mid-1970s, the Saint Joseph
  school provided a Catholic education for young people in the Rowena
  area; other parish organizations have also flourished, including
  the Bishop Forrest Council of the Knights of Columbus, Saint Ann's
  Altar Society, Catholic Daughters of the Americas, and the KJT and
  KJZT men's and women's fraternal organizations; and
         WHEREAS, Rowena has undergone many changes in the past 100
  years, but Saint Joseph Catholic Church has remained a constant in
  the lives of its congregants since its founding, and it stands today
  as a testament to the faith and dedication of its members, both past
  and present; now, therefore, be it
         RESOLVED, That the 80th Legislature of the State of Texas
  hereby congratulate Saint Joseph Catholic Church on its centennial
  and extend to its parishioners best wishes for the future; and, be
  it further
         R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
  prepared for the church as an expression of high regard by the Texas
  House of Representatives and Senate.
